Transaction e12e0b7aaca78fe22fabe41b15572604668d8e64de4c6bad3e45d6a7852e69f5
1 Input
1 Output
-
e12e0b7aaca78fe22fabe41b15572604668d8e64de4c6bad3e45d6a7852e69f5:0
- value
- 18210632
- script pubkey
- OP_0 OP_PUSHBYTES_20 96f286ce95bacd89b7d55bbbb1efbca69824947d
- address
- bc1qjmegdn54htxcnd74twamrmau56vzf9rancm65h